Every day I travel through the reasonably pleasant suburban north Kent town of West Wickham. I was aware of the fact that John Surtees had once occupied a motorcycle shop somewhere around the High Street, but was unsure as to the whereabouts of it.
Until recently, a furniture shop had been located in one of the buildings on the far east end. A few weeks ago it closed down. While passing by I was surprised to see that the signs had been taken down and in their place one could see the 40-year-old original signs bearing the faint outline of 'JOHN SURTEES'.
The original signs are no longer visible and the premises will soon reopen as a maths and English tuition centre.
